The Emergency Response Team (ERT) is seeking students for a team lead.
Summary Of Responsibilities
- Maintain documentation for all ERT members
- Certifications/Licensure for EMT/Paramedic
- BLS cards on all team members
- ERT Application
- HIPAA forms
- Review applications for new volunteer team members/hire
- Coordinate Event Coverage:
- UCCU Events
- Other on-campus events
- Ensure accurate invoicing is occurring for campus events/UCCU events. If there are payment issues, involve the Director of Emergency Management/Safety.
- Maintain Equipment:
- Jump bags for ERT Campus Response
- Jump bags for Event Coverage
- Restocking bags
- Ranger vehicle maintenance (gas, oil changes, other issues)
- Provide weekly training for ERT
- Coordinate with the training officer for monthly training
- SOP review and update
- Must be a current UVU student
- Hours, for the most part, will be during the day, Monday-Friday. There may be times for training or filling in during events when nighttime hours are necessary. Of the 20 hours per week, 5 hours should be to cover 1 shift per week.
- Education/Certifications: EMT Basic or higher (EMT advanced, Paramedic, etc.), must show licensure for EMT/Paramedic. BLS Certified, Instructor Preferred
- Knowledge of and skill in applying basic on-site emergency medical protocol and procedures.
- Knowledge of related accreditation and certification requirements.
- Ability to maintain quality, safety, and/or infection control standards.
- Ability to perform standardized emergency patient care activities within the established protocol.
- Ability to react calmly and effectively in emergencies.
- Ability to interact well with people.
- Ability to lift 30-50 pounds.
- Have computer skills and be able to use relevant software such as Microsoft Word and others.
